A relaxed Mother’s Day weekend in LYH filled with fresh air, local favorites, and simple moments that make Mom feel special. Whether it’s a peaceful walk, a great meal, or simply slowing down together, it’s all about making Mom feel celebrated in the places locals love most!
Arrive in Lynchburg and check into your hotel or local stay. Whether you choose a cozy Airbnb or a convenient spot like Bella Vista Hotel & Suites, take some time to unwind and get settled before the weekend begins.
Ease into the evening with a scenic drive through Historic Downtown LYH or a quick walk at Riverside Park. It’s a quiet, beautiful way to kick off the weekend and enjoy a little fresh air together.
📍 Riverside Park – 2238 Rivermont Ave
📍 Downtown LYH
Kick off Mother’s Day weekend with an elevated dinner at Isabella’s Italian Trattoria. Known for its cozy atmosphere and refined Italian dishes, it’s the perfect spot for a relaxed but special evening.
📍 4925 Boonsboro Road
Start the day with coffee at Nomad Coffee at Blackwater Creek Trail for a peaceful morning walk surrounded by nature.
Browse local vendors, pick up fresh flowers, and explore one of the area’s most beloved spots at the Lynchburg Community Market. Then, take a stroll along Main Street to pop into nearby boutiques and shops, perfect for picking out a little something special for Mom or simply enjoying the local charm.
📍 1219 Main Street
Keep it fun and local with brunch at My Dog Duke’s Diner, Market at Main, or Tiger Sun Restaurant & Lounge all local favorites in Downtown LYH.
📍 My Dog Duke’s Diner – 1007 Commerce Street
📍 Market at Main – 907 Main Street
📍 Tiger Sun Restaurant & Lounge –
Head to River Ridge for shopping, browsing, and exploring local shops. Then, head to Hill City AquaZoo for a unique, hands-on experience with marine life. It’s a fun and unexpected stop that adds something memorable to the weekend.
📍 3405 Candlers Mountain Road
Ease into the evening at Palmera House, a beautifully curated space known for its wine, cocktails, and lush, plant-filled atmosphere. It’s the perfect spot to relax, catch up, and toast to the weekend before dinner.
📍 2307 Bedford Avenue
Celebrate Mom with an elevated dinner at The Dahlia. With its refined menu and intimate ambiance, it’s an ideal setting for a memorable night out.
📍 2221 Bedford Avenue
Start the day with a cozy, celebratory brunch. Enjoy a relaxed morning exploring downtown favorites for a mix of sweet, savory, and classic brunch options. Think mimosas, coffee, and a slow start to the day.

Head to Old City Cemetery and wander through gardens filled with antique roses and seasonal blooms. It’s a peaceful, meaningful way to spend time together and soak in the beauty of spring in LYH.
Where to Find Spring Blooms in LYH
📍 401 Taylor Street
For a quiet and scenic outing, take a short drive to Thomas Jefferson’s Poplar Forest. Explore the grounds, tour the historic home, and enjoy a slower pace just outside the city.
📍 1776 Poplar Forest Parkway

Before heading out, stop by Mellow Mushroom, Beer 88, or Neighbor’s Place for a casual, easy bite. Known for its laid-back vibe and local feel, it’s the perfect way to wrap up the weekend without rushing.
Take one last stroll or enjoy a quiet moment together, ending the weekend feeling refreshed, connected, and celebrated!
📍 Mellow Mushroom – 1220 Greenview Drive
📍 Beer 88 – 113 Hexham Drive
📍 Neighbor’s Place – 104 Paulette Circle
